在现代互联网应用中,小程序已经成为一种流行的应用形式,尤其是在移动设备上。许多企业和开发者希望通过网页跳转到小程序,以便更好地嵌入生态圈并提升用户体验。那么,网页如何实现跳转到小程序链接呢?本文将详细探讨实现这一功能的方法及操作细节。

一、小程序链接的格式

我们来看一下小程序的链接格式。小程序的链接通常是一个特定的URL,包含了 appid(小程序的唯一标识符)和 path(小程序目标页面的路径)。例如,以下是一个典型的小程序链接格式:

https://mp.weixin.qq.com/wxopen/wayfinding?appid=小程序appid&path=小程序路径

通过这种格式的链接,用户能够直接跳转至指定的小程序页面。

二、设置网页跳转小程序的入口

在网页中添加小程序链接,可以使用标准的 HTML 标签和 JavaScript。常见的实现方式包括使用链接标签和 JavaScript的 window.location 方法。以下是实现过程的基本步骤:

1. 使用标签

创建一个简单的超链接,点击后直接跳转到小程序。例如:

<a href="https://mp.weixin.qq.com/wxopen/wayfinding?appid=小程序appid&path=小程序路径">打开小程序</a>

用户只需点击该链接,即可打开指定的小程序。

2. 使用JavaScript跳转

如果你希望在用户进行特定操作后自动跳转到小程序,可以使用 JavaScript:

<script>
function openMiniProgram() {
window.location.href = "https://mp.weixin.qq.com/wxopen/wayfinding?appid=小程序appid&path=小程序路径";
}

// 假设在某个事件中调用该函数
document.getElementById("myButton").onclick = openMiniProgram;
</script>

<button id="myButton">点击打开小程序</button>

这种方式更为灵活,能够根据用户行为触发跳转。

三、微信小程序的扫一扫功能

除了直接通过链接跳转,微信小程序还提供了扫一扫功能,可以通过扫描二维码来打开。如果你希望在网页中集成这一功能,可以生成二维码并提供给用户扫描。

<img src="https://api.qrserver.com/v1/create-qr-code/?data=https://mp.weixin.qq.com/wxopen/wayfinding?appid=小程序appid&path=小程序路径" alt="打开小程序二维码">

用户扫描二维码后,同样能够成功跳转到小程序。这种方式十分适合线下场景,通过海报、名片等媒介传播。

四、注意事项

在实现网页跳转到小程序时,需注意以下几个要点:

1. 设备兼容性

尽管小程序在微信内兼容性良好,但不同设备、不同浏览器可能会影响用户体验。在设计跳转链接时,建议进行充分的测试,确保在手机端表现良好。

2. 权限设置

确保小程序的链接权限正确设置,避免用户在跳转过程中遇到相关的错误提示,例如未授权访问等。小程序的后台管理系统可以进行权限的调整与配置。

3. 跳转链接的有效性

定期检查网页中的小程序跳转链接,确保其有效性。如果小程序链接发生更改,需及时更新网页中相应的链接,避免用户出现404错误或显示空白页面。

五、总结

通过上述方法,网页跳转到小程序链接的实现便不再是难题。无论是直接使用链接,还是通过 JavaScript 实现更为动态的行为,都是非常有效的手段。同时,不要忽视了二维码的应用,它为用户提供了更多便利。通过合理设计并测试,你可以为用户带来流畅且高效的应用体验。

希望本文能够帮助你了解网页如何跳转小程序链接的相关知识,让你的应用更具活力与效益。